Best Tarrant County Public Middle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 141 public middle schools serving 86,066 students in Tarrant County, TX.
The top ranked public middle schools in Tarrant County, TX are George Dawson Middle School, Carroll Middle School and Iuniversity Prep.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Tarrant County, TX public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 42% (versus the Texas public middle school average of 43%), and reading proficiency score of 53% (versus the 52% statewide average). Middle schools in Tarrant County have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of Texas public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 75%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is equal to the Texas public middle school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
